mwdb-cli
CLI and Python client covering the full MWDB Core API (all 122 operations)
Overview
mwdb-cli is a Python toolkit to work with MWDB Core (CERT.pl's malware database) from the command line or as a library. It covers every operation of the MWDB Core API — all 122 operations of spec 2.18.0 — with an async-native core, a synchronous facade, and machine-readable outputs including JSON, TOON and SARIF 2.1.0.
Key Features
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Full API coverage | All 122 operations of MWDB Core 2.18.0, enforced by a spec regression test |
| Async + sync | Async-native client with a synchronous facade over the same implementation |
| Multi-format output | Rich tables, JSON, TOON, and SARIF 2.1.0 |
| Typed models | Dataclasses for files, configs, blobs and objects, keeping the full raw payload |
| Concurrent transfers | Bulk downloads with --jobs; blocking I/O offloaded to threads |
| Resilient transport | Automatic retry/backoff on 429/5xx and typed exceptions |
| CLI + Library | Use the mwdb command or import the Python package |
| 100% tested | Live tests against a real MWDB instance (no mocks), 100% coverage |

Configuration
Settings resolve in order: CLI flags / constructor arguments → environment → config file → defaults.
export MWDB_URL="https://mwdb.cert.pl" # default
export MWDB_API_KEY="<your API key>"
or ~/.mwdb.toml:
[mwdb]
url = "https://mwdb.cert.pl"
api_key = "<your API key>"

Usage
Command Line Interface
mwdb file get <sha256>
mwdb search 'tag:emotet AND file.size:[* TO 500000]'
mwdb file download <sha256> <sha256> ... --jobs 8 -o samples/
mwdb file download <sha256> --zip -o samples/
mwdb file upload sample.bin --tags my-tag --share-3rd-party false
mwdb tag add <sha256> my-tag
mwdb comment add <sha256> "packed with UPX"
mwdb config list --query 'config.family:emotet'
mwdb attribute add <sha256> source '{"feed": "honeypot"}'
mwdb --json file get <sha256> | jq .tags
Every API area has a command group:
file, config, blob, object, tag, comment, attribute, share,
relation, karton, quick-query, auth, user, api-key, group,
attribute-def, metakey, oauth, remote, server, plus top-level
search. Run mwdb <group> --help for the operations in each group.
Global options: --url, --api-key, --config, --format, --json.
Output Formats
--format selects how results are rendered (default: table):
| Option | Description |
|---|---|
--format table |
Human-readable rich tables (default) |
--format json |
Pretty JSON (--json is a backward-compatible alias) |
--format toon |
TOON: compact, token-efficient for LLMs |
--format sarif |
SARIF 2.1.0 findings |
mwdb --format toon file list # tabular TOON block
mwdb --format sarif file list # SARIF 2.1.0 document
mwdb --json file get <sha256> # same as --format json
SARIF is a findings schema, so it is available only for commands that
return samples or objects (file/config/blob/object list and get,
and search). Each object becomes one SARIF result (artifact = sha256,
ruleId = family/tag/type). Other commands report
SARIF output is not available for this command.
Python Library
Async
import asyncio
from pathlib import Path
from mwdb_cli import AsyncMwdbClient
async def main() -> None:
async with AsyncMwdbClient() as client: # settings from env/config file
async for sample in client.files.iterate(query="tag:emotet"):
print(sample.sha256, sample.file_name)
await client.files.download(sample.id, Path(sample.id))
break
asyncio.run(main())
Sync
from mwdb_cli import MwdbClient
with MwdbClient() as client: # same API surface, runs the async core internally
for sample in client.files.iterate(query="tag:emotet", chunk_size=50):
print(sample.sha256)
stats = client.configs.stats()
Concurrent bulk work
from pathlib import Path
from mwdb_cli import AsyncMwdbClient
from mwdb_cli.bulk import run_limited
async def bulk(client: AsyncMwdbClient) -> None:
hashes = [f.id async for f in client.files.iterate(query="tag:emotet")]
await run_limited(
[lambda h=h: client.files.download(h, Path(h)) for h in hashes],
limit=8,
)
TOON and SARIF encoders
from mwdb_cli import sarif, toon, MwdbClient
with MwdbClient() as client:
samples = client.files.list(query="tag:emotet", count=20)
print(toon.encode([s.raw for s in samples])) # compact TOON
if sarif.is_supported(samples):
document = sarif.encode(samples) # SARIF 2.1.0 dict
Errors are typed: AuthError, ForbiddenError, NotFoundError,
ValidationError, ConflictError, RateLimitError, ServerError,
MwdbConnectionError — all subclasses of MwdbError. Rate-limited and
transient 5xx responses are retried automatically with backoff.
Development
Quality gates (all must pass clean, with no suppressions):
black --check . && ruff check . && mypy .
bandit -r -c pyproject.toml . && pip-audit
MWDB_API_KEY=<key> pytest # live suite, 100% coverage enforced
The test suite talks to a real MWDB instance (no mocks): read operations run for real; mutating admin operations are exercised against requests the server rejects (missing capability → 403, nonexistent object → 404), so production data is never modified. Transport edge cases (retries, malformed bodies) run against a real in-process HTTP server.
